Discovery of the Atom

  • Solid Sphere model

    First atomic model. Hypothesized an atom is a solid sphere and can not bedivided smaller
  • Plum Pudding model

    the atom is composed of electrons surrounded by a soup of positive charge to balance the electrons' negative charges
  • Nuclear model

    the protons and neutrons, which comprise nearly all of the mass of the atom, are located in the nucleus at the center of the atom. The electrons are distributed around the nucleus and occupy most of the volume of the atom
  • Bohr model

    shows that the electrons in atoms are in orbits of differing energy around the nucleus (think of planets orbiting around the sun). Bohr used the term energy levels (or shells) to describe these orbits of differing energy. ... The energy level an electron normally occupies is called its ground state.
  • quantum mechanics model

    treats electrons as matter waves. ... An atomic orbital is defined as the region within an atom that encloses where the electron is likely to be 90% of the time.
